Shana Dwyer - Principal/Co-owner
With 20 years teaching experience, Shana has taught children from the tender age of 2 through to the golden age of 67 to dance. Running a studio independently for 14 years, and preparing students for Examinations has rewarded her credibility as a teacher with a 100% pass rate from all participating students. Students have won and or placed in various Dance Scholarships, Competitions, and have been accepted in auditions for dance tours to Hong Kong for the annual Dancexpo, representing ATOD.

With the help of ATOD, Shana has travelled widely over Australia as a Demonstrator of Syllabus work. Shana has been sent as an ATOD Syllabus Demonstrator to Indonesia (2005), Singapore (2006) and Thailand (2010), where the syllabus is also studied. which is also an ATOD teaching tool nationally and internationally.

Shana has worked with Etienne Khoo and Shane Clarke from DVP in Melbourne on Australia's 1st Hip Hop Syllabus. She has also filmed with Shane Preston and Paul Davis from "Tap Dogs" on the new Street Tap Syllabus devised for ATOD.Shana will continue to deliver her passion to all students who are willing to learn well into the future.

 

Travis Roberts - Hip Hop Teacher/Co-owner
Travis started teaching in 2002, specialising in street and hip-hop and trained with the best in Australia the Trick Nasty Crew. In 2000 he completed the C.A.D. (Centre of Artistic Development) program at Macgregor State High, a 2-year program majoring in drama as well as travelling to Hong Kong to dance at the world dance expo. Competing in competitions in night clubs around Brisbane he met up with TNC in 2002. He trained intensively throughout 2003 for Australian Hip-Hop Championships in Adelaide placing 2nd only to be beaten by his trainers. Then selected to compete in the World Championships to represent Australia in 2004. He has also danced in numerous film clips, just recently the "Britney Spears" of Asia, Hirsho.

KimKim Smith - Jazz
Qualifications
Ad Dip - Australian Ballet School - TC
RAD Teaching Certificate
CSTD Teachers Certificate - Tap

Kim grew up in South Australia beginning her dance training at the age of six. At the age of 17 she relocated to Melbourne to continue full time training & later went on to gain her Advanced Diploma in teaching whilst with the Australian Ballet School.

For the following 6 years Kim taught full time with various ballet/dance schools throughout Victoria, South Australia & Queensland, along with performing & choreographing for a wide range of professional performances/shows. Her performing then took her further abroad to Japan as part of a magic/song & dance act & from there Kim continued traveling whilst dancing in the Cruise Ship industry for a further 5 years. Living amongst & experiencing various cultures is one of the most valuable experiences of ones life & a real eye opener. To be able to incorporate this with working in a field which you are most passionate about was & still is a dream come true.

Kim has now established herself here on the Gold Coast involved in all styles/genres of dance including classical ballet, hip hop, jazz, contemporary & tap. She continues to perform locally with song/dance trio “Unlimited Vibe”.
